While Synergy uses the terminology "points per possession" to describe how they measure production, that's very misleading when you're used to looking at KenPom. I'm switching over to describing Synergy stats as "points per play." The distinction is described in this useful Cleaning The Glass post:

CTG distinguishes between possessions and plays, and this distinction is important when diving into context information. A possession starts when a team gets the ball and ends when they lose it. A play ends when the team attempts a shot, goes to the foul line, or turns the ball over. If a team gets an offensive rebound, that results in a continuation of a possession but a new play. So a possession can have multiple plays.

Play contexts are per-play, not per-possession. For example, a team might come down in transition and miss a shot, get the offensive rebound, kick it out, and run a halfcourt set. Then might miss that shot but get a tip in to score and end the possession. That was all one possession, but three different plays and three different contexts: the first shot was in transition, the second in the halfcourt, and the third was a putback.

Because offensive rebounds start a new "play" within a possession, points per play are inherently going to be lower than points per possession. To help contextualize, I've included each player's national percentile rank for that season along with their stats.

For ballhandlers, "own offense" includes plays that finish with a field goal attempt, shooting foul, or turnover. "Passes" measure the result of shots that come as a direct result of the ballhandler's pass out of the pick-and-roll. "Keep percentage" is a stat I added myself that simply measures the percentage of a time the ballhandler uses his own offense instead of recording a passing play—Michigan has had players arrive at similar efficiency despite sporting very different styles.

For screeners, you mostly just need to know the difference between popping, rolling, and slipping a screen:

  • Popping: setting the screen and then stepping out (usually to the three-point line) for what's almost always a spot-up shot. Occasionally a more versatile big man will drive off a pop. Think Moe Wagner.
  • Rolling: setting the screen and then going to the basket in the hopes of getting a layup/dunk. Think Jordan Morgan.
  • Slipping: faking the screen before running to a predesignated spot—usually the rim, sometimes spotting up if it's a Wagner-type or perimeter player—as a changeup to keep defenses from overplaying the ballhandler.

As a general rule, points per play are going to higher when the screener finishes the play than the ballhander because of the nature of the pick-and-roll. A pass is usually going to be thrown to an open man when the play works; while the ballhandler could take a shot because he got open himself, he also usually has to finish the play if it's well defended.

Consider the degree of difficulty of Zavier Simpson's or Cassius Winston's shots; it's hard to be a really efficient scorer off the pick-and-roll. Morgan, while a great roll man, often just had to catch the ball and finish an uncontested shot at the rim. Most of Wagner's pick-and-pop threes went up without a real shot contest. This makes sense: there's little reason to pass the ball to your big man if he isn't open. Teams also often default to a quick screen in late clock situations, which tends to create more difficult shots the ballhandler has little choice but to take.

The other thing to note in the screener stats: under number of plays in each category, "%" shows the percentage of the time each player popped, rolled, or slipped out of their overall screener plays used. The "%ile" under points points play in each category, however, measures percentile national rank. I realize this is a little confusing but I couldn't come up with a better way than Synergy in this case.

In the last three games, Michigan earned their status as the team to beat in the Big Ten by sandwiching road wins at Wisconsin and Michigan State around a home victory over Iowa; all three teams ranked in the AP top ten when they played the Wolverines and sit at #6 (Iowa), #8 (MSU), and #14 (Wisconsin) in the latest KenPom rankings. Michigan ranks #7 on KemPom themselves after entering the Kohl Center at #19.

This brilliant three-game stretch also vaulted Nik Stauskas up the NBA Draft boards (from unranked to #14 in Chad Ford's latest rankings[$]), gave him the inside track for Big Ten MVP, and landed him the #8 spot in the KenPom POY standings. Before I get to the video breakdown, here are Stauskas' numbers from the last three games:

  • 68 total points (22.7/game) on 10/19 2-pt, 12/24 3-pt, 12/13 FT shooting
  • 13 assists to five turnovers, 11 rebounds (one off.), three blocks, three steals
  • 28 points generated by assists (includes FTM)
  • 96 points generated on 74 possessions used* for a mark of 1.30 points per possession
  • Let me state that again: 1.30 POINTS PER POSSESSION

Keep in mind that, while Wisconsin is struggling defensively (#10 in B1G defensive efficiency), Michigan State and Iowa rank first and third in the Big Ten in defensive efficiency. Those numbers are patently ridiculous; just as impressive is the variety of ways Stauskas generated those points. Stauskas scored in just about every fashion imaginable, regardless of how opponents tried to defend him, and created most of his points himself—only six of his points and two of his assists came off non-transition spot-up opportunities.
